> My suggestion is to, by default, bind some movement behaviors to the M-p
> and M-n keys. Currently, the default left and right cursor movement keys
> are bound to C-f/b for going forward or backward by character, and M-f/b
> to go forward/backward by word.
Thank you for your suggestion.
I've often wondered what if anything could be bound to M-p, M-n, and
I always ended up with the conclusion that keeping them free for use by
local modes to be the best option.
Maybe it's just laziness on my part, of course.
